Memo to records: The Moth & Lantern tour props come back from the Carverton run this week. Log each crate against the prop register before storage — especially the mechanical owl, which is fragile and insured separately. When the courier arrives for the owl's onward transfer, give them this instruction exactly:

dispatch memo: the eliok quenok courier leaves the sorael aldath belion tammir casix gileth queniel jorath ledger at gate 9299 under passcode 897989

Handover — Training Budget, Next Year

For the incoming director: training envelope drafted at last year's level plus inflation uplift. Certification renewals for the Brindle works crew are committed; do not cut. Leadership cohort with the Fennick Institute is optional — decide by month three. Unspent external-course funds lapse; no carryover. Approval sits with Director Mersey until you formally take the seat. The confidential business-plan note is appended below this line.

board note of kageg-bahof: The renewal with Holwynax Holdings closes at $2 million a year, 5 percent below the last contract. Project Ulaath slips by two quarters because of the supplier delay.

Quarterly Planning Note — Joint Venture Proposal with Abervane Optics

Heads of department: the proposed joint venture with Abervane Optics has cleared preliminary diligence. Capital contribution would be split 60/40, with governance shared through a joint steering committee based in Lunmarsh. Risks identified so far concern IP carve-outs and supply commitments. A decision memo is due next month. Sensitive terms under negotiation appear in the confidential note below.

confidential, kagup-bafog: Fraaxax Group is in early talks to buy Soroxox Group for about $343.8 million. The Olidor launch date is June 14, and nothing goes to the press before then. Legal wants the Aldmirek Logistics term sheet signed before July 23.